软件编程属于技术吗为什么
-
是的,软件编程属于技术。技术是指应用科学知识和技能解决实际问题的过程。而软件编程是运用科学知识和技能创建和开发软件的过程。以下是我对软件编程属于技术的几点理由:
首先,软件编程需要掌握一定的理论知识和技术技能。编程语言、算法和数据结构等基础知识是进行软件编程的基础。同时,掌握开发工具和相关的开发环境也是必要的技能。通过学习和实践,程序员能够熟练掌握这些知识和技能,从而能够解决实际问题并开发出高质量的软件产品。
其次,软件编程需要具备解决问题的能力。编程不仅仅是写出一段代码,更重要的是能够理解和分析实际问题,并将其转化成计算机能理解和执行的语言。这对于软件开发人员来说需要具备一定的逻辑思维和问题解决能力,他们需要能够将复杂的问题分解成多个步骤,并设计出相应的解决方案。
另外,软件编程还需要良好的沟通和合作能力。在实际的软件开发过程中,往往需要多人协同合作。程序员需要与其他团队成员进行交流和沟通,共同完成项目的开发。这要求程序员具备良好的沟通能力和团队合作精神,以确保项目能够按时高质量地完成。
最后,软件编程是一个不断学习和更新的过程。计算机技术的发展迅猛,新的编程语言、框架和技术不断涌现。作为软件开发人员,需要不断学习并跟随技术的发展,以保持自己的竞争力并能够适应不同的项目需求。
综上所述,软件编程属于技术。它需要具备一定的理论知识和技术技能,能够解决实际问题并开发出高质量的软件产品。同时,软件编程也要求具备良好的沟通和合作能力,并且需要不断学习和更新以适应技术的发展。
1年前 -
是的,软件编程属于技术。以下是几个理由:
-
技术要求:软件编程需要掌握特定的技能和知识,包括编程语言、算法和数据结构等。只有通过系统学习和实践才能掌握这些技术。
-
创造性和解决问题能力:软件编程是将创造性和解决问题的能力应用于实际的软件开发过程。从分析问题到设计解决方案,再到编写代码和调试错误,程序员需要通过创造性思维和解决问题能力来开发高质量的软件。
-
需求变化和技术演进:软件编程是一个不断变化和发展的领域。随着技术的不断进步和用户需求的不断变化,程序员需要不断学习新的技术和工具,以适应这种变化。
-
工程管理:软件编程涉及到软件工程的各个方面,包括需求分析、项目管理、软件测试等。这要求程序员具备良好的组织和管理能力,以确保软件项目的顺利进行和高质量的交付。
-
影响力和经济价值:软件编程的成果可以直接影响到人们的生活和工作,可以提高效率、降低成本、改善用户体验等。同时,软件产业也是一个庞大的经济体系,在全球范围内创造了大量的就业机会和经济效益。
因此,软件编程被认为是一项技术,需要具备相应的技能和知识,同时也具备创造性、解决问题和管理能力。它在技术演进、需求变化、经济价值等方面都具有重要的影响和作用。
1年前 -
-
是的,软件编程属于技术。
软件编程是指通过使用编程语言和工具来创建、测试和维护计算机程序的过程。它涉及到对问题进行分析、算法设计和实现的技术方面。
首先,软件编程需要技术知识和技能。软件编程要求程序员具备扎实的计算机科学基础知识,了解计算机的内部工作原理和编程语言的特性。编程过程中需要运用算法、数据结构、逻辑思维等技术来解决问题,还需要掌握各种编程工具和开发环境的使用。
其次,软件编程是一门创造性的技术。通过编程,我们可以创造出新的软件产品和功能,解决现实世界中的问题。编程需要创造性的思维和创新的能力来设计和实现新的解决方案。编程过程中,程序员需要思考并提出合适的算法和设计模式,以达到预期的效果。
另外,软件编程也需要良好的问题解决能力。编程过程中,程序员常常会遇到各种问题和错误,需要通过分析和调试来解决。问题解决能力是技术人员必备的重要能力,对于软件编程也是如此。解决问题需要灵活运用各种技术方法和工具,同时也需要具备耐心和持续学习的精神。
总结来说,软件编程是一门需要技术知识和技能的创造性技术。它需要程序员具备计算机科学知识、算法设计能力、创新能力和问题解决能力。因此,可以说软件编程属于技术。
1年前